Maine Soil Conditions and Aggregate Performance

Piscataquis County soils generally classify as glacial till with high clay percentages. This creates expansion and contraction during freeze-thaw cycles, leading to frost heaving that can damage improperly constructed driveways and foundations. Properties in Sangerville, whether near the historic textile mill sites along the river or in the residential areas extending toward North Village, all share these challenging soil characteristics. The solution lies in proper aggregate selection and installation depth.

Aggregates must penetrate below the frost line, which in central Maine extends approximately 48 inches deep. For most residential applications, a properly compacted base of 12-16 inches provides adequate protection. The key is using angular, crushed aggregates that interlock mechanically rather than rounded materials that shift under load. This is why crusher run and crushed stone varieties consistently outperform smooth river gravel for structural applications in Sangerville's demanding conditions.

Best Aggregates for Common Sangerville Projects

Residential Driveway Construction

Driveways represent the most common aggregate application for Sangerville homeowners. Whether you're on a rural property near Guilford or maintaining a residence in the village center, your driveway endures significant stress from snow removal equipment, vehicle weight, and seasonal temperature extremes. The ideal driveway system uses a layered approach: a base layer of larger aggregates for structural support and drainage, topped with finer material that compacts to a smooth, durable surface.

For base layers, crushed stone provides excellent results. Its angular shape allows pieces to lock together, creating a stable foundation that resists shifting. This base should extend 8-12 inches deep depending on traffic levels. For the surface layer, crusher run compacts beautifully, creating a firm driving surface that handles Maine winters effectively. Properties along River Road and areas near the Dover-Foxcroft town line particularly benefit from this robust construction method due to higher traffic volumes and heavier vehicles.

Drainage Solutions for Wet Properties

Many Sangerville properties struggle with seasonal wetness, particularly those in lower-lying areas near the Pleasant River or in naturally low spots where spring snowmelt accumulates. French drains constructed with proper drainage aggregates solve most water management problems effectively. The system requires digging a trench, installing perforated pipe, and surrounding it with clean, angular stone that allows water to flow freely while filtering out soil particles that could clog the pipe.

Number 57 stone works exceptionally well for drainage applications because its uniform size and angular shape create maximum void space for water movement. For properties dealing with significant water issues, such as those near marsh areas or seasonal wetlands common in the North Village region, combining French drains with proper grading and surface water management creates comprehensive solutions. The investment in proper drainage protection pays dividends by protecting foundations, preventing basement moisture, and extending the life of driveways and other hardscaping.

Foundation and Construction Work

New construction and major renovations require stable, well-draining aggregates beneath slabs and around foundation walls. Road base provides an excellent foundation material because it combines various aggregate sizes that compact to a dense, stable layer. This material works particularly well for garage floors, shed foundations, and similar structures throughout Sangerville where a level, stable base is critical.

For foundation drainage, installing drain rock against basement walls before backfilling prevents water accumulation against the foundation. This is especially important in Sangerville given the clay-rich soils and high water table in many areas. Proper foundation drainage, combined with exterior waterproofing and functioning gutters, creates a comprehensive moisture management system that protects your investment for decades.

Aggregate Type Best Applications Size Range Drainage Rating Maine Winter Performance
Crusher Run Driveway surfaces, base layers Fines to 1 inch Good Excellent - compacts firmly
3/4" Crushed Stone Drainage, base work, general use 3/4 inch Excellent Excellent - resists frost heave
#57 Stone French drains, septic systems 3/4 inch uniform Excellent Excellent - maintains voids
Road Base Heavy-duty foundations, roads Fines to 1.5 inch Good Excellent - superior strength
Pea Gravel Decorative, pathways, gardens 3/8 inch Good Good - minimal shifting
River Rock Landscaping, water features 1-3 inches Fair Fair - decorative use only
Crushed Concrete Base layers, temporary roads Varies Good Good - economical option

Maximizing Aggregate Performance in Maine

Proper installation determines whether aggregates perform well for decades or fail within a few years. Maine's harsh conditions punish poor installation while rewarding quality work. These guidelines help ensure successful results for Sangerville property owners investing in aggregate improvements.

Excavation Depth and Preparation

Proper excavation removes unstable material and creates space for adequate aggregate depth. For driveways, excavate to remove all organic material, soft soil, and existing failing base. Most residential driveways in Sangerville need 12-16 inches of total aggregate depth to perform reliably through Maine winters. Subdivide this into base and surface layers. For properties with particularly troublesome soils, such as those in low-lying areas with high clay content, deeper excavation and additional aggregate depth provide better long-term results.

Compaction Techniques

Aggregates must be properly compacted to achieve designed performance. This requires appropriate equipment - typically a plate compactor for smaller areas or a vibratory roller for driveways and larger projects. Install aggregates in lifts (layers) of 4-6 inches, compacting each lift thoroughly before adding the next. This ensures uniform density throughout the depth. Proper compaction prevents settling, maintains surface smoothness, and creates the interlocking structure that resists frost heaving. Many failed aggregate installations in Sangerville trace back to inadequate compaction rather than poor material selection.

Drainage Integration

Every aggregate installation should consider drainage. Even well-constructed driveways and paths fail if water accumulates beneath them. Crown driveways slightly (2-3% slope) to shed water toward edges. Install swales or drainage ditches to capture and direct runoff away from aggregate surfaces. For properties on slopes, consider cross-drains beneath driveways to prevent water from channeling along the driveway base. These details seem minor during installation but prove critical during spring melt and heavy rainstorms common throughout the year in Sangerville.

Calculating Your Aggregate Needs

Ordering the correct amount of aggregates eliminates delays and reduces costs. The basic calculation multiplies length times width times depth, with depth converted to feet. For example, a driveway 100 feet long by 12 feet wide with 10 inches of aggregate requires: 100 × 12 × 0.833 = 1,000 cubic feet, or approximately 37 cubic yards. Always order 10-15% extra to account for compaction, irregular surfaces, and waste.

Common Project Quantities

  • Standard residential driveway (100' × 12' × 10" deep): 35-40 cubic yards total
  • Small parking area (20' × 20' × 8" deep): 10-12 cubic yards
  • French drain system (100' trench × 1' wide × 2' deep): 7-8 cubic yards of drain rock
  • Garden pathway (50' × 3' × 3" deep): 1.5-2 cubic yards of pea gravel
  • Foundation drainage (perimeter of 30' × 40' foundation): 8-10 cubic yards of drainage aggregate

Maintaining Your Aggregate Installations

Proper maintenance extends the life of aggregate driveways and paths significantly. In Sangerville's climate, regular attention prevents small problems from becoming expensive repairs. Address these maintenance tasks seasonally for best results.

Spring Maintenance

After winter snowmelt, inspect aggregate surfaces for low spots, erosion channels, and areas where base material has migrated. Fill depressions promptly with matching material to prevent water pooling and accelerated deterioration. Rake and redistribute surface materials that plow trucks displaced during snow removal. Check drainage systems to ensure they flow freely after winter freeze-thaw cycles potentially shifted pipes or clogged inlets.

Summer Upkeep

During dry summer months, aggregate surfaces develop washboard patterns from vehicle traffic. Periodically grade and compact these surfaces to restore smoothness. Add fresh surface material as needed to maintain proper crown and depth. Control weeds growing through aggregates by applying appropriate herbicides or using landscape fabric beneath installations. Properties along River Road and other high-traffic areas may need grading multiple times during summer.

Fall Preparation

Before winter arrives, ensure all drainage systems function properly. Clean ditches and culverts of leaves and debris. Fill any depressions or holes in aggregate surfaces to prevent ice formation in low spots. Consider applying a thin layer of fresh surface material if the existing surface shows significant wear. These preventive measures reduce winter damage and make spring maintenance easier.

Winter Snow Removal

Proper snow removal technique protects aggregate surfaces while maintaining accessibility. Set plow blades slightly higher than the surface to avoid catching and displacing aggregates. Use stakes to mark edges, preventing plows from damaging lawns or pushing aggregates into unintended areas. Consider alternatives like snow blowers for sensitive areas or decorative aggregate installations that plowing would damage.

Frequently Asked Questions About Aggregates in Sangerville

What aggregate type works best for Maine driveways?

Crusher run and three-quarter inch crushed stone provide the best results for Sangerville driveways. Crusher run compacts to a smooth, firm surface for the top layer, while crushed stone creates an excellent drainage base. Both resist frost heaving and handle heavy snow removal equipment effectively. The angular shape of crushed aggregates creates mechanical interlock that prevents shifting during freeze-thaw cycles common throughout Piscataquis County.

How deep should aggregate driveways be in Sangerville?

Most residential driveways need 12-16 inches of total aggregate depth to perform reliably through Maine winters. Install this in layers: a base layer of larger stone for drainage and structure, topped with finer crusher run that compacts to a smooth surface. Properties with particularly soft or clay-rich soils may benefit from 16-18 inches of depth. Always excavate below the topsoil level and remove any organic material before installing aggregates.

When is the best time to install aggregates in Maine?

Late spring through fall provides the best installation window in Sangerville. May through October offers consistently favorable conditions with thawed ground and warm temperatures that allow proper compaction. Early spring after mud season ends works well for replacing failing driveways. Avoid installation during winter when frozen ground prevents proper excavation and compaction. Schedule major projects for completion by early November before the ground freezes.

How do I prevent my gravel driveway from washing out?

Proper installation with adequate depth, good compaction, and appropriate crown prevents most washout problems. Install drainage systems to intercept and divert water before it reaches your driveway. Use larger aggregates like three-quarter inch crushed stone for base layers, which resist movement better than smaller materials. For driveways on slopes, install cross-drains or speed bumps to break water flow and prevent channeling. Regular maintenance including filling low spots and maintaining crown also prevents water accumulation that leads to washout.

What size aggregate do I need for French drains?

Number 57 stone works ideally for French drain installations around Sangerville properties. This clean, angular stone maintains consistent three-quarter inch size that creates maximum void space for water movement while preventing pipe clogging. The uniform sizing ensures water flows freely through the aggregate to reach perforated drain pipe. Avoid rounded river rock or pea gravel for drainage applications, as these materials compact too tightly and restrict water flow, reducing system effectiveness.

Can I install aggregates over existing gravel?

Installing new aggregates over existing material only works if the existing base remains stable and properly graded. If the current driveway has failed, shows significant rutting, or drains poorly, complete removal and fresh installation produces better long-term results. For driveways in reasonable condition needing only surface renewal, adding 2-4 inches of fresh crusher run provides economical improvement. However, properties experiencing ongoing problems benefit from complete reconstruction with proper depth and drainage, especially given Sangerville's challenging soil conditions and severe winters.

How long do aggregate driveways last in Maine?

Properly installed aggregate driveways last 15-25 years in Sangerville with regular maintenance. Lifespan depends on installation quality, drainage effectiveness, traffic levels, and maintenance consistency. Driveways that receive annual grading, prompt repair of washouts, and periodic addition of fresh surface material last significantly longer than neglected installations. Maine's freeze-thaw cycles and heavy snow removal equipment accelerate wear compared to milder climates, making quality initial installation and ongoing maintenance especially important for longevity.

What's the difference between crusher run and crushed stone?

Crusher run combines various aggregate sizes from fines to one inch, creating material that compacts extremely well for smooth, firm surfaces. Crushed stone consists of uniform-sized angular rock, typically three-quarter inch, that provides excellent drainage and structural support but doesn't compact as tightly. Most Sangerville driveways use both: crushed stone for the base layer providing drainage and stability, topped with crusher run creating a smooth driving surface. This layered approach combines the strengths of both materials for optimal performance in Maine conditions.
